Prey to me is the most remarkable modern attempt at (re)proposing the System Shock formula, it does almost everything right without compromising/streamlining the core mechanics too much. The atmosphere itself doesn't quite reach the heights of the past, but the space station's design can be consistently rewarding when it comes to exploration and experimentation. The narrative never holds your hand with passive silly cinescripted scenes either and encourages reading the various logs, which boosts the immersion factor. I basically echo what Yondy said. Razz

I'd recommend playing it on the hardest difficulty *and* with a minimal HUD though ( https://community.pcgamingwiki.com/files/file/928-prey-interface-customizer/ ), since otherwise the game would just turn into your GPS-sim with little sense of danger involved. You'll be an overpowered overlord near the end anyway, but still!

So finished it (base) and meh. It's not a bad game, but it's not all that good either.

I turned down the difficulty to easy and eventually to story, just to make it bearable. It's a lot of walking/flying from A to B. Lots of going through the same places again and again. The combat is boring (hence why I set the difficulty lower), it's more about "fight or not", than "how". You pretty much use whatever you have (left) to kill whatever is in front of you. The story also just drags on and on and it's just so meh.


I give it a 6.5/10.

I'm saying, it never really is there, to begin with.

Simply giving you 3 options each time to go from A to B, is not a choice, it's an illusion of choice because you still have to go to B in the end. Also, the "options" just keep repeating yourself, depending on your skills and/or approach. Manipulate stuff, use bolt caster to hit a button, find the maintenance access, use leverage to clear an entrance. Sure, there are a couple of different ways to get from A to B, but you'll just do them over and over. And for the later game, I assume you mean once Dahl arrived, yeah, I felt it went all away and it was just run from A to B and back again. As I said, I had level 2 Machine Mind, so I just kept right-clicking the military controllers and they kept killing each other, lol. But there was indeed not even the illusion of choice left. It was just straight-up running.

To be honest, the thing that kept me going, was Alex. He was by far the best voiced and I actually wanted to hear what he had to say. Everything else was just white noise to me.
